Greta Johnson
Dr. Greta Johnson is a Research Analyst II, working in the Center for the Development of Teaching at Education Development Center in Newton, MA. Dr. Johnson holds a BS degree from Tufts University where she studied Child Development and Early Childhood Education. She earned an M.Ed. and Ed.D. from Harvard University, both in the field of Human Development. Her thesis explored the impact of social network contexts on the child rearing beliefs and practices of mothers of infants. On the TMI project, Dr. Johnson's research interests include investigating the myriad of factors that may support or impede change in the thinking and professional practice of school administrators for supervision of their mathematics instructional faculty.
